About the role
The COMSEC Manager supports Department of Defense (DoD) agencies, including HQ Air Force, Office of the Secretary of Defense (OSD), and Military Compartments efforts. The role provides “day-to-day” support for Collateral, Sensitive Compartmented Information (SCI), and Special Access Program (SAP) activities.
Responsibilities
- Conduct secure equipment (e.g., secure telephone and encryption devices) and classified keying material inventories, inspections, and other COMSEC related support and oversight functions.
- Perform installation of secure telephone equipment (STE) and coordinate to deliver encryption device(s) and keying material to selected Information Technology (IT) specialists maintaining classified networks.
- Administer a Top-Secret inventory and document control program to account for COMSEC equipment and materials.
- Conduct inventories per agency policy and report any discrepancies to the government customer.
- Courier classified information and authorize receipts for classified materials.
- Ensure Automated Information Systems Security requirements, related to COMSEC duties, are complied with.
- Ensure proper physical security accreditation has been issued by designated Program Security Officers for supported facilities.
- Train personnel in COMSEC procedures and the use of related equipment.
